During remodeling of our kitchen, we don't have a lot of counter space (yet) so I created this magnetic spice rack for the back of the oven. This was made for ovens that are 30" wide.
There are 3 sizes of trays
Tray x1 - the smallest (during size testing, I found this one to be smaller than intended, but someone might have a use for it.) You can fit up to 10 on this system.
Tray x2 - medium tray, twice as big as Tray x1. Can fit up to 5
Tray x3 - largest tray, 3 times as long as Tray x1. Can fit 3 on this system, but will have space left over on the sides (could add a Tray x1 for small stuff)
There are also a left and right cover which I found unnecessary, but someone might want them.
I chose to go with Tray x3 (2) and Tray x2 (2).
The bottom part has spots for 8 magnets each, and you will need 5 bottom pieces total (40 magnets for a 30" oven). The ones I used are

The bottom was printed with supports and in the orientation in the file. The angled part goes toward the front of the oven.
Assembly
Slide the trays together using the dovetail connectors, then slide onto the magnetic base using the dovetail channel on the bottom of the trays. The magnets that were ordered are fairly strong for being so little and with 8 on each, the bottom won't move unless you make it.
